Prison for killing and skinning a cat on Snapchat

A 20-year-old man was sentenced in France on Friday to two years in prison, including eight months, for killing and skinning a cat while filming himself before posting the videos on Snapchat.

At the beginning of November 2022, the young man posted several videos on the Snapchat social network that showed a cat being slaughtered. In several messages, he explained that he killed the cat by shooting it in the head with a lead bullet.

At first instance, the accused was sentenced to 10 months imprisonment, including 4 months, but the prosecutor’s office appealed this decision. And the Metz Court of Appeal in eastern France increased its sentence on Friday.

“The Court of Appeal was well aware of the facts committed by the accused, the verdict is much more satisfactory than that of the first instance,” Me Laure Vayssade, the association’s lawyer, told AFP. “Stéphane Lamart for the Defense of Animal Rights”.

The SPA, the Brigitte Bardot Foundations, 30 Million Friends and Animal Assistance were also civil parties.

Between 2016 and 2021, the number of attacks on pets increased by 30% to 12,000 recorded facts in 2021 (particularly abuse, serious abuse and cruelty), the French Interior Ministry said at the end of October.

Interior Minister Gérald Darmanin took the opportunity to announce the creation of a department of investigators made up of 15 specialized police officers and gendarmes “specifically in charge of animal cruelty”.

The Animal Cruelty Act, which came into force on November 30, 2021, has tightened the existing penalties: The fact that a “grave abuse” or “cruelty” is committed to an animal can now be punished with up to three years imprisonment and a Fine of 45,000 euros.
